On 2010-02-25, Rob Richardson <Rob.Richardson@rad-con.com> wrote:
> If you are worried about your application still being in use 90 years
> from now, you have to take into account the fact that 2100 will not be a
> leap year.

this is beauty of implementing it using date arithmetic all the
horrible wrinkles are someone elses resposibility, and have been
well tested.
